Claims Administrator

Claims Administrator

10 Jan 2025
Tennessee, Nashville, 37201 Nashville USA

Claims Administrator

We are looking for someone to be a key contributor to the success of our Legal team.  If you’re an independent thinker who isn’t afraid to ask questions, and if you’re organized in a way that never overlooks the details, please keep reading.Ingram Barge Company has an opening for a Claims Administrator based out of our Nashville, TN offices.  In this hybrid role, you will be supporting and collaborating with staff in the administration of claims matters, including management of correspondence, clerical, administrative, and legal tasks. A successful claims administrator will be proactively organized, and process oriented. What you will be doing:Claims administrative dutiesAdvising internal and external stakeholders on processes necessary for prompt claim paymentsAnswering phones and providing directions to internal and external stakeholders regarding claim status and documenting files to record the same.Securing updated W9’s for A/P processing of claims.Managing all mail for the Claims department to include preparation of invoices for medical bill review and A/P.Managing digital invoices and upload to OnBase system for A/P processing.Sending vendor authorizations to Accounts Payable to set up vendors for payment.Preparing and distributing introductory and long-term disability letters for Jones Act employees.Extended absence compensation and interruption of Voyage compensation data entry.Collaborating with Barge Maintenance & Repair staff to secure appropriate invoices for processing.Preparing and distributing maintenance spreadsheets for Adjuster review, approval, and A/P processing.Ordering supplies for department as appropriateSecuring and paying final invoices on inactive files and close claimSpecial projects as assignedClaims software administration duties: Approving payments and exports to Accounts PayableEntering record payments, managing exceptions reportAssisting with troubleshooting of systemsFacilitating any updates.

Related jobs

  • Description We are offering a long term contract employment opportunity for a Claims Admin Support Specialist in Nashville, Tennessee. As a Claims Admin Support Specialist, you will undertake clerical duties, customer service responsibilities, and office functions. You will also be required to interact with multiple internal and external contacts, maintain office supplies, and operate office equipment.

  • Taking care of people is at the heart of everything we do, and we start by taking care of you, our valued colleague. A career at Sedgwick means experiencing our culture of caring. It means having flexibility and time for all the things that are important to you. It’s an opportunity to do something meaningful, each and every day. It’s having support for your mental, physical, financial and professional needs. It means sharpening your skills and growing your career. And it means working in an environment that celebrates diversity and is fair and inclusive.

  • About Sutherland

  • Job Description

  • Taking care of people is at the heart of everything we do, and we start by taking care of you, our valued colleague. A career at Sedgwick means experiencing our culture of caring. It means having flexibility and time for all the things that are important to you. It’s an opportunity to do something meaningful, each and every day. It’s having support for your mental, physical, financial and professional needs. It means sharpening your skills and growing your career. And it means working in an environment that celebrates diversity and is fair and inclusive.

  • Description

  • Description

Job Details

Jocancy Online Job Portal by jobSearchi.